indices sobre datos binarios

From: Mª José Sempere <mjose(at)pixelart(dot)es>
To: <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: indices sobre datos binarios
Date: 2004-12-03 12:02:29
Message-ID: 000001c4d92f$f926b3d0$0900a8c0@mj
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Hola a todos

Buscamos información sobre campos de tipo binario.
En concreto hemos encontrado dos tipos posible,
el bytea y el blob.
Hemos definido una tabla uno de cuyos campos ha de ser binario.
Queremos que en dicha tabla no exista más de un registro con el mismo campo
(binario) identico. Hemos visto que sobre un campo de tipo
bytea puede declararse un índice único, pero sobre uno de tipo blob no.
Queríamos saber si para tablas con muchos registros y datos bianrios con
gran tamaño, p.e. 10kbytes,
la existencia del índice ralentiza la inserción de registros (ya que
al ser un índice único, antes de insertar debería comprobar que
no existe ya ningun otro igual).

Tambien querríamos saber cómo implementa PostgreSql a nivel interno esta
comparación entre campos de tipo bytea (si ha de ir comparando los
contenidos del campo o si está optimizado de alguna manera, por ejemplo con
utilización de CRC o cualquier otra cosa).

Si alguien tiene experiencia en este tipo de problemas,
le agradeceremos su ayuda.

Salu2 a todos

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Marcelo Retamal Vallejos 2004-12-03 13:02:27 Re: poblemas con la asignacion de privilegios
Previous Message Alejandro Ren Fernndez Blanco 2004-12-03 11:16:02 Re: Conversin de Access 97 a Pg 7.4.6